Sheltering the wild

Sponsored by Bogota's Ministry of Environment, this Colombian shelter receives between 3,000 and 3,500 wild animals a year; some seized from poachers and others found hurt. An estimated $560,000 U.S. dollars are spent in the recovery and care of these animals. Seventy percent of rescued animals are reintroduced to their habitat and the remaining 30% are sent to zoos around the country.

A 15-day-old night monkey sits in a veterinarian's palm. (AP Photo/Fernando Vergara)
